Animator and collage artist Una Gildea demonstrates how to turn collages into stop motion animation with the help of pupils from Larkin Community College. Watch the clip up top where she tells us about the process.
Ross works with pupils from St Edna's Primary School to create the sights of Dublin’s fair city using plasticine and a painted backdrop.
Shane helps pupils from Our Lady of Lourdes Secondary School in Wexford create a cardboard metropolis. Using only recycled materials, the girls create a utopian cityscape.
And the Transition Year’s from Adamstown Community College work with Ala Buisir to create a photography exhibition for their local train station.
